Envirothon
The Envirothon consists of five outdoor learning stations including soils, wildlife, water resources, forestry and current environmental issues. Teams include three to five high school students that compete on the environmental subjects. Each team has approximately 25 minutes at each station where they work together to answer the questions asked by the natural resource professional. Each team is also responsible for a ten minute oral presentation about the current environmental issue.
The Area VII Envirothon is sponsored by the eleven county SE Minnesota Soil and Water Conservation Districts (Freeborn, Mower, Fillmore, Houston, Winona, Olmsted, Dodge, Rice, Wabasha, Goodhue and Steele.) The top three teams compete at the state level and then the top team at the state will compete at the national level.
The 2011 Area VII Envirothon was held at Chester Woods County Park near Rochester, Minnesota on Thursday, May 5th. Only eight teams participated this year. The Zumbrota/Mazeppa #2 team placed first, the Goodhue #2 team placed second and the Medford #1 team placed third.
